What is the shape of the uppercase letter Q?

The shape of the uppercase letter Q is typically round with a tail that curves downward from the bottom right.

What sound does the letter Q typically make in English?

In English, the letter Q typically makes the sound /kw/, as in the words "queen" or "quick.

Can the letter Q be used as the first letter in a word in English?

Yes, the letter Q can be used as the first letter in a word in English. Examples of words that start with the letter Q include "queen," "question," "quick," and "quiet.

What is the name of the lowercase letter Q?

The name of the lowercase letter Q is "cue.

Can you find any objects or animals that start with the letter Q?

Yes, some examples of objects or animals that start with the letter Q are quill (writing tool), quokka (Australian marsupial), and quiver (container for holding arrows).
